Josée-Ann Cloutier

Josée started to meditate as a path and practice in 1999, and began the meditation instructor path in 2008 in the Shambhala tradition. She’s now on an eco-dharmic path that she integrates in her work and life. She started Steam Space in 2016 hosting and facilitating wood-fired mobile group sauna sessions as a community enterprise. Steam Space is now a facilitation, wellness design and consultation business specializing in rituals and retreats that center ecological and community care. She’s the Founding Director of Circulate, a non-profit organization that started in 2023 to foster a sense of belonging and well-being by offering affordable and accessible complementary care practices that center nature connection in group and community settings.
